Creates a server socket at a given port and binds to it. Returns -1 on error. 0 on success.
vtkClientSocket* vtkServerSocket::WaitForConnection | ( | unsigned long | msec = 0 | ) |
Waits for a connection. When a connection is received a new vtkClientSocket object is created and returned. Returns NULL on timeout.
int vtkServerSocket::GetServerPort | ( | ) |
Returns the port on which the server is running.
